Why Should Crypto Have Prediction Markets?

Prediction markets operate on an intuitive and primal principle: users value, or stake, the outcome of some future event. If many people place a big stake on a particular result, the market assumes an inclination toward that outcome. With crypto as the subject matter, it evolves into forecasts related to token price, network upgrades, platform launches, or drastic regulatory events. Unlike conventional markets or simple opinion polls, prediction markets are a system of financial incentives that forces the participant to actually research and make bets with reasonable accuracy.

As prices undergo swift gyrations due to rapidly changing sentiments, markets ensure that real-time consensus is achieved. They turn collective intellect from a worldwide participant base into actionable information. How Zephyr Works for Crypto Market Prediction

The Zephyr prediction system is operated by opening various prediction markets for different topics. Each market has at least two possible outcomes. For example, one market might ask whether Ethereum would close above $4,000 this month. Participants go ahead and buy shares to either the “Yes” or to the “No” outcome. As the deadline nears, market activity aggregates the sentiment in the community. After the outcome is realized, those who predicted correctly are rewarded proportionally to their share in the total stake.

Since the blockchain is involved, this ensures transparency and immutability. Every market activity is recorded on-chain, thereby resisting any manipulation and central control. This fosters a sense of trust among users and lends credibility to the platform.

Challenges and Limitations

Yet, in spite of their usefulness, several obstacles confront the Zephyr and other prediction markets. Liquidity is one of the biggest constraints. Some markets may just not attract enough participants to be meaningful. Zephyr solves this by providing rewards, gamified incentives, and social tools for boosting the participant rate.

Oracle-based identity issues raise more difficulty with the fair determination of the outcome of the prediction market based on credible data. Zephyr uses a decentralized approach to resolve results, but continued trust requires clear definitions and reliable sources for data.
